The Girl with the Louding Voice
At fourteen, Adunni dreams of getting an education and a steadier life for her family. Instead, her father sells her into an arranged marriage with an old man. When tragedy strikes, Adunni flees to Lagos, becoming a house-girl to the cruel Big Madam. Life grows harder, but Adunni refuses to be silenced. Her courage, grit, and relentless hope push her toward a future where her voice finally matters—and someone hears her.

About the Author:
Abi Daré grew up in Lagos, Nigeria, and has lived in the UK for over eighteen years. She studied law at the University of Wolverhampton and earned an MSc in International Project Management from Glasgow Caledonian University, as well as an MA in Creative Writing at Birkbeck, University of London. The Girl with the Louding Voice won the Bath Novel Award for unpublished manuscripts in 2018 and was selected as a finalist in the 2018 Literary Consultancy Pen Factor competition. Abi lives in Essex with her husband and two daughters, who inspired her to write her debut novel.
